How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Tuscarora?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Tuscarora Studio Apartments | $1,725 | $1,100 | $2,052 |
Tuscarora 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,057 | $1,375 | $8,630 |
Tuscarora 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,220 | $1,419 | $6,362 |
Tuscarora 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,022 | $1,616 | $10,000+ |
